Why use a native platform

Performance Functionality
-

Access to device capabilities


-

Camera, contacts, compass, calendar, etc.

Push notifications Native platforms are designed for the device App store / Marketplace is where mobile users look first

Usability
-

Market penetration
-

Easier to monetize

Why web platform

Code reuse / budget One development environment Targeting multiple devices


-

Modifications needed for each device but development environment is the same

Limited device access Full control over deployment


-

No approval process No app store

Faster to production

Deployment to the GIS community

Write once deploy multiple (sort of)

Never seamless between platforms


-

Tweaks are always necessary: iOS to Android to Windows Phone Tablets may warrant their own interface Style appropriately for platform Dojox.mobile likely easiest approach Adobe Flex SDK Hero + Adobe Flash Builder Burrito

JavaScript compact build

JavaScript API with smaller footprint (~30kb)


-

No dijits Limited modules Dojox.mobile, jQuery mobile, jQtouch, Sencha Touch, etc. Build native app from JavaScript Development requirements vary by targeted platform

Can use with variety of JavaScript toolkits


-

PhoneGap (Some access to phone capabilities)


-

No limitations on platform, developer platform or IDE

Using the JavaScript compact build

Load modules not included if they are needed


-

dojo.require(esri.tasks.query) Check manifest to see if new code is available

Use Application cache (HTML 5) to store code locally


-

Samples available on mobile at http://links.esri.com/javascript ProtoFluid is a great app for testing page size of devices http://app.protofluid.com/
-

Use in conjunction with FireBug to debug layout on desktop
